Output 84ebbba273f4d1cb4acd14118a69fb8ed24d58b4dbd91e356094c5a4af827812:1

value
21084354
script pubkey
OP_0 OP_PUSHBYTES_20 45488a07f3273c7b0db20b43e70fe70039bf047d
address
ltc1qg4yg5plnyu78krdjpdp7wrl8qqum7prafgw7r0
transaction
84ebbba273f4d1cb4acd14118a69fb8ed24d58b4dbd91e356094c5a4af827812
spent
true